Calculate Log Base 385 of 126

To solve the equation log 385 (126) = x carry out the following steps.
  1. Apply the change of base rule:
    log a (x) = log b (x) / log b (a)
    With b = 10:
    log a (x) = log(x) / log(a)
  2. Substitute the variables:
    With x = 126, a = 385:
    log 385 (126) = log(126) / log(385)
  3. Evaluate the term:
    log(126) / log(385)
    = 1.39794000867204 / 1.92427928606188
    = 0.81237766296178
    = Logarithm of 126 with base 385
